Comparison between Intel Core i7-10700K and A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X
Intel Core i7-10700K is manufactured by Intel, while A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X is manufactured by AMD.
Intel Core i7-10700K has a higher base speed of 3.8 GHz compared to A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X's 3.5 GHz.
Intel Core i7-10700K has a higher turbo speed of 5.1 GHz compared to A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X's 4.0 GHz.
A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X has more cores (12) compared to Intel Core i7-10700K's 8 cores.
A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X supports more threads (24) compared to Intel Core i7-10700K's 16 threads.
Both CPUs belong to the same class: Desktop.
Intel Core i7-10700K uses the FCLGA1200 socket, while A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X uses the sTR4 socket.
Intel Core i7-10700K was launched in Q2 2020, while A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X was launched in Q3 2017.
A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X has a larger L3 cache of 32 MB compared to Intel Core i7-10700K's 16 MB.

Pro's and Con's
Intel Core i7-10700K – Pros and Cons
Pros:
Higher Base Clock Speed: The Intel Core i7-10700K has a higher base clock speed of 3.8 GHz compared to the A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X's 3.5 GHz. This results in better performance for single-threaded tasks and general responsiveness.
Higher Turbo Boost Speed: The Intel Core i7-10700K supports a higher turbo boost speed of 5.1 GHz compared to the A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X's 4.0 GHz. This allows for better performance during peak workloads.
Faster Single-Core Performance: With a single-threaded performance score of 3048, the Intel Core i7-10700K outperforms the A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X (score: 2316). This makes it better suited for tasks that rely on single-core performance, such as gaming or everyday productivity.
Cons:
Fewer Cores: The Intel Core i7-10700K has 8 cores, which is fewer than the A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X's 12 cores. This could impact performance in multi-threaded workloads, such as rendering, compiling code, or running virtual machines.
Fewer Threads: The Intel Core i7-10700K has 16 threads, which is fewer than the A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X's 24 threads. This may limit its ability to handle highly parallel workloads efficiently.
Lower Multi-Core Performance: In multi-threaded tasks, the Intel Core i7-10700K scores 18736, which is lower than the A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X's score of 23104. This makes the AMD Ryzen Threadripper 1920X a better choice for heavy multitasking or parallel processing.
